This job is no longer available

Digital Business Director

Central London£85k

Company Overview:

Our client, a vibrant leading Global Media Agency is looking for a Digital Business Director. This is a great opportunity to work with the next generation marketing services agency.

Job purpose:

Working across a key client, the candidate will work with the Partner to manage the relationship between the agency and the client. As the digital lead for the business, core responsibilities include digital thought leadership, strategy, network support and commercial/revenue development.

Reporting structure:

The Business Director reports into the Global Partner of the Client team and has the ability to tap into specific disciplines (Search, Social, etc) and resources as required. Supporting the role, there is a broader client team in place, with two direct digital reports (Digital Account Directors).

Principal responsibilities:

  • Manage the day to day relationship with the Global Account clients, working closely with their senior leadership (Global Head of Media and Global Head of Digital), to win their trust and become a core advisor for future digital engagement.
  • In support of the client’s vision for digital leadership, work to develop a digital strategy and subsequent pillars to deliver, with close integration of Paid, Owned, Earned media (through a variety of competencies – ecommerce, mobile, social, search, etc).
  • In addition to developing and delivering the global vision in digital (with strong emphasis on thought leadership), support markets in making this come to fruition at local, in-market levels, using best practice from around the world.
  • Work with global and regional media clients, brand teams and creative agencies to develop effective communications campaigns and strategies. In doing so, oversee internal team to manage day-to-day operations, overseeing Scopes of Work, managing resources, and galvanizing resources to deliver client needs.
  • Oversight of key strategic initiatives, including developing training programmes and processes, creating best-in-class learnings, and building the client’s digital understanding and skillset through strategic guidance and thought leadership.
  • Market our successes –sourcing and share award entries, case studies, etc across the markets and with the Global client to raise the profile of The agency’s digital capabilities and drive incremental revenue
  • Anticipate client needs, the challenges that face them and work with Partner to develop action plan for addressing issues and championing ideas which drive innovation and change.

Key Challenge:

A top client for the agency, the Client is highly demanding in both technical digital understanding and ability to formulate and articulate strategic needs, winning over local teams and agency partners. Due to the level of client profile, the Account is often an incubator and driver of key agency-wide initiatives, with management oversight from the Worldwide Head of Digital and Strategy. In addition, client exposure is frequently c-level (or just below), making the role ideal for candidates who are looking for challenge and recognition. As a result, candidates must have the ability to deliver under pressure, with genuine innovation, passion and vision.

Key skills & knowledge:  

  • 10+ years media agency experience working on a large multi-national client, preferably in a central/regional capacity. Media agency experience preferred.
  • Proven experience in client leadership, with ability to manage senior level clients.
  • Strong written, presentation and verbal skills.
  • Understanding of all communication channels, with a deep knowledge of digital (and ability to speak to a broad range of digital topics).
  • Proven track record of business growth in agency revenue.
  • Ability to prioritize deliverables with team and client to ensure smooth delivery, responding to changing workloads with flexible approach.
  • Strong organizational and management skills a must, with ability to navigate complex client-matrix organizations.
  • Capable of working autonomously, to oversee digital deliverables on a regular basis.
10 April 2014
10 May 2014
ID2418
Agency
Full Time
Permanent
Looking for a change? Just tell us the type of job you're after and we'll do the hard work.